Ferran Torres Addresses Trump Hat Controversy, Keeps Barcelona Exit Open
Barcelona forward Ferran Torres has addressed the controversy surrounding a hat he wore during a World Cup celebration, which bore the slogan of former US President Donald Trump. Torres stated that he is not knowledgeable about politics and downplayed the significance of the headwear. He also commented on his future at the club, suggesting that "in football, you never know," indicating that his departure from Barcelona is still a possibility. This statement leaves his future with the team uncertain, as he has not yet made a final decision. The forward's comments aim to quell the political debate while simultaneously keeping the door open for a potential transfer.
